
一、开头段落
在Excel表格中显示重复的文字可以通过使用条件格式、利用公式、数据验证等方法来实现。使用条件格式是一种直观且高效的方法,它可以通过颜色、字体等样式来突出显示重复的内容。在这里,我们将详细介绍如何通过使用条件格式来识别和显示重复的文字。
使用条件格式来显示重复的文字是一种非常实用的技巧,尤其是当你需要快速识别和处理数据中的重复项时。首先,你需要选择你想要检查的单元格范围,然后通过Excel的条件格式功能来设置规则,最后应用这些规则来突出显示重复的内容。这个过程不仅简单,而且非常有效,能够帮助你在大量数据中快速找到重复项。
二、使用条件格式
1、选择单元格范围
首先,打开你的Excel文件,并选择你要检查的单元格范围。这一步非常重要,因为你需要确保你选中的范围包含所有你想要检查的单元格。
例如,如果你的数据在A列中,那么你需要选择A列的所有单元格。你可以点击列标A来选择整列,也可以拖动鼠标来选择特定的单元格范围。
2、设置条件格式规则
在选择好单元格范围后,点击Excel菜单栏中的“条件格式”按钮。然后,从下拉菜单中选择“突出显示单元格规则”,接着选择“重复值”。
此时,Excel会弹出一个对话框,允许你设置如何显示重复的值。你可以选择不同的颜色和字体样式来突出显示这些重复的值。
3、应用条件格式
在设置好条件格式规则后,点击“确定”按钮,Excel将会自动应用这些规则,并突出显示你选中的单元格范围内的重复内容。你会看到所有重复的文字都被高亮显示,这使得你可以轻松地识别和处理这些重复项。
三、利用公式
1、使用COUNTIF函数
除了使用条件格式,利用公式也是一种非常有效的方法。你可以使用Excel的COUNTIF函数来查找和显示重复的文字。COUNTIF函数的语法为:COUNTIF(range, criteria)。
例如,如果你想检查A列中的重复项,你可以在B列中输入以下公式:
=COUNTIF(A:A, A1)>1
这个公式会返回一个布尔值,如果A1在A列中出现多次,则返回TRUE,否则返回FALSE。
2、结合IF函数
你还可以将COUNTIF函数与IF函数结合使用,以便在单元格中显示具体的重复次数。例如,你可以在B列中输入以下公式:
=IF(COUNTIF(A:A, A1)>1, "重复", "唯一")
这样,当A1在A列中出现多次时,B1会显示“重复”,否则显示“唯一”。
四、数据验证
1、设置数据验证规则
数据验证功能也可以用于显示和管理重复的文字。首先,选择你想要应用数据验证的单元格范围,然后点击Excel菜单栏中的“数据”按钮,接着选择“数据验证”。
在弹出的对话框中,选择“自定义”选项,然后在公式框中输入以下公式:
=COUNTIF($A$1:$A$100, A1)=1
这个公式的意思是,如果A1在A1到A100范围内只出现一次,则数据有效,否则无效。
2、应用数据验证
设置好数据验证规则后,点击“确定”按钮。现在,当你在选定的单元格范围内输入重复的文字时,Excel会弹出一个警告对话框,提醒你输入的数据已经重复。
五、使用VBA宏
1、编写VBA代码
对于高级用户来说,使用VBA宏来显示重复的文字也是一种非常灵活和强大的方法。你可以编写一个简单的VBA宏来遍历你的数据,并突出显示所有重复的项。
例如,你可以使用以下VBA代码来实现这一点:
Sub HighlightDuplicates()
Dim rng As Range
Dim cell As Range
Dim dict As Object
Set dict = CreateObject("Scripting.Dictionary")
Set rng = Range("A1:A100")
For Each cell In rng
If Not IsEmpty(cell.Value) Then
If dict.exists(cell.Value) Then
cell.Interior.Color = RGB(255, 0, 0)
Else
dict.Add cell.Value, Nothing
End If
End If
Next cell
End Sub
这个宏会遍历A1到A100范围内的所有单元格,并将所有重复的文字高亮显示为红色。
2、运行VBA宏
编写好VBA代码后,按下F5键或者从菜单中选择“运行”来执行这个宏。你会发现所有重复的文字都被高亮显示,非常直观。
六、总结
通过使用条件格式、利用公式、数据验证和VBA宏等方法,你可以轻松地在Excel表格中显示重复的文字。每种方法都有其独特的优点和适用场景,选择适合你需求的方法可以大大提高你的工作效率。使用条件格式是最简单和直观的方法,适合大多数用户;利用公式则提供了更高的灵活性和精确度;数据验证可以帮助你在数据输入阶段就避免重复;而VBA宏则适用于需要处理大量数据的高级用户。
相关问答FAQs:
1. 为什么我的Excel表格中的重复文字显示方式不同?
在Excel中,重复文字的显示方式取决于你所使用的版本和设置。通常情况下,Excel会自动对重复的文字进行条件格式化,以使其在视觉上更易于识别。但是,如果你的Excel版本较旧或者你的设置进行了更改,重复文字的显示方式可能会不同。
2. 如何在Excel表格中自定义重复文字的显示方式?
如果你想自定义Excel表格中重复文字的显示方式,可以使用条件格式化功能。首先,选择包含重复文字的单元格范围。然后,点击Excel菜单栏中的“开始”选项卡,在“样式”组中选择“条件格式化”。接下来,选择“突出显示单元格规则”并选择“重复的数值”或“重复的文本”选项。在弹出的对话框中,选择你想要的显示样式,如字体颜色、背景颜色等。最后,点击确定以应用自定义的重复文字显示方式。
3. 如何将Excel表格中的重复文字标记为“重复”而不进行视觉上的突出显示?
如果你不想在Excel表格中对重复文字进行视觉上的突出显示,而只是希望将它们标记为“重复”,可以使用Excel的公式。在一个空白列中,输入以下公式:=IF(COUNTIF(A:A,A1)>1,"重复","")(假设重复文字所在的列为A列)。然后,将该公式拖动到该列的其他单元格中。这样,重复的文字将被标记为“重复”,而其他单元格将为空白。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4242808